North Central, located between Temple University and Fairmount Park, is a residential and institutional Philadelphia neighborhood with rowhouse blocks and campus-edge energy.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around Broad Street at Cecil B. Moore Avenue, where corner takeouts, student hangouts, and SEPTA entrances keep the sidewalks in motion. Temple Performing Arts Center anchors nights of concerts and talks, while The Liacouras Center draws big-game and event crowds. Brick twins and porch-front rows mix with newer mid-rises near campus corridors. Pocket greens and rec spaces break up the grid, with longer walks leading toward the park’s trails. Daily rhythms shift from classroom bustle to quieter side streets lined with murals and stoops.

The CMX-2, Neighborhood Commercial Mixed-Use district is primarily intended to accommodate active commercial and mixed-use development, including neighborhood-serving retail and service uses. The range of allowed uses is broader than the CMX-1 district
